2,2-Difluoroethylacetate is a versatile compound widely used in chemical synthesis as a valuable building block in the creation of various organic molecules. Due to its unique structure containing fluorine atoms, this compound offers important reactivity and selectivity advantages in synthetic processes. In particular, 2,2-Difluoroethylacetate is commonly employed as a key intermediate in the synthesis of pharmaceuticals, agrochemicals, and materials with specialized properties. Its distinct properties make it a valuable tool for organic chemists looking to introduce fluorinated groups into target molecules, enabling the production of novel compounds with enhanced biological activities or materials with improved performance characteristics.
